Understanding 24-Inch Bicycle Rims

24-inch bicycle rims are commonly found on children’s bicycles, BMX bikes, and some specialized mountain bikes designed for younger riders or those who prefer a smaller wheel size. The size of the rim influences not only the overall feel of the bike but also how it handles different terrains and conditions. Rims act as the interface between the tires and the frame; getting the right fit is crucial.

Why Choose 24-Inch Rims?

Choosing a 24-inch rim can offer numerous advantages, especially for specific types of cycling. For children or shorter riders, these rims provide a more manageable bike that’s easier to control. Additionally, smaller wheels can improve maneuverability, making them a favorite for BMX riders who require quick handling for tricks and stunts.

Materials Matter: Aluminum vs. Steel

When selecting 24-inch bicycle rims, one of the primary considerations revolves around the material. The two most common materials are aluminum and steel. Each has its pros and cons:

  • Aluminum: Lightweight and resistant to rust, aluminum rims enhance speed and performance. They are typically stiffer, which can provide better responsiveness.
  • Steel: Durable and affordable, steel rims are ideal for heavy-duty applications. However, they tend to be heavier, which can impact acceleration and overall maneuverability.

Rim Width: Finding the Right Fit

Rim width is another critical aspect of rim selection. Wider rims can allow for wider tires and offer improved stability, while narrower rims are lighter and can enhance aerodynamics. Here’s a quick breakdown of what to consider:

  • Narrow Rims (20-25mm): Best for road and racing bikes, providing quick acceleration and reduced weight.
  • Medium Rims (25-30mm): Ideal for a balance of speed and stability; great for all-purpose cycling.
  • Wide Rims (30mm and above): Perfect for mountain biking and rough terrain, giving better grip and traction.

Braking System Considerations

Understanding the type of braking system your bike uses is vital when selecting 24-inch bicycle rims. Rim brakes and disc brakes can affect rim selection:

  • Rim Brakes: You’ll need rims that are compatible with rim brake pads. Ensure the braking surface is smooth and damage-free for optimal performance.
  • Disc Brakes: These rims do not have a braking surface, making them more lightweight and offering better heat dissipation. Ensure to check compatibility with your bike’s frame and fork.

Installation and Maintenance Tips

Once you have selected the right 24-inch rims, proper installation and maintenance are key to getting the most out of your purchase. Here are some tips:

  • Check for True Alignment: After installing the rims, ensure they are true (not wobbling) for the best performance.
  • Regular inspections: Check for wear and tear, particularly on the braking surface, to ensure safety.
  • Maintain proper tension: Regularly check spoke tension to prevent rim deformation.

Exploring Alternatives: 24-Inch Rims vs. Other Sizes

While 24-inch rims have their benefits, it’s essential to consider alternatives based on your biking needs. For instance, 20-inch rims are generally favored for BMXing, while 26-inch and 27.5-inch rims typically provide enhanced stability for mountain biking. Each size has its unique advantages; assessing your cycling style and preferences is vital before making a choice.
